Rate The News With Neozeno's New Mobile App, Launching On Kickstarter
EntSun News/10771409
ANNAPOLIS, Md. - April 3, 2019 - EntSun -- NeoZeno is building a mobile app where YOU can rate news articles and pressure journalists to improve their standards. Today the team launched a crowdfunding campaign on Kickstarter to finish the last stages of development.
"We want the public to have a say in how news gets reported." – Sam, NeoZeno Co-Founder and CEO
Users can submit news articles to rate bias, impact, and quality. Each rating is combined with millions of others to create an overall credibility score for that article. NeoZeno plans to use these ratings to track the performance of individual journalists and publications to put public pressure on improving journalistic standards.
The Kickstarter campaign will run from April 3rd to May 8th with a fundraising goal of $10,000. The team is raising funds for thorough testing of app features and its anti-bot mechanisms. "We're using a first-of-its-kind method of social engineering to prevent bots and fake accounts on our platform." Zach, Co-Founder and Tech Director of NeoZeno.

The app requires a subscription of $1.99 per month for unlimited ratings, which acts as a deterrent to those who want to influence news ratings. Zach explains, "creating enough fake accounts to manipulate the data would come at a high cost and be easily detectable in our database." The co-founders also promise to never use ads or collect and sell personal data like other free social media platforms.
Who is NeoZeno?
The company, founded in 2018, is a bootstrapping start-up with only two co-founders, Zach and Sam, who identify as normal people that simply wanted to do something about the news. "We expect accurate and reliable news, but can only find articles that tell us what to think," says Sam from NeoZeno. "Our app is a way for people to call out problems that have gone unchecked in journalism."
Launch of the NeoZeno app is scheduled for June 2019 on Android devices—an iOS launch will follow soon after. Users will be able to rate an unlimited amount of news articles for a subscription fee of $1.99 per month, or be limited to basic features with three ratings per day. Other features include trending news feeds, profile badges, and a comment section for each rated news article. You can find out more about the app on their webpage neozeno.com
